Original Description
Hippolyte Petitjean’s Baigneuse Se Coiffant (Bather Arranging Her Hair) is a captivating example of Neo-Impressionist painting, blending the delicate luminosity of Pointillism with an intimate, poetic subject. Created in the late 19th or early 20th century, Petitjean—a student of the movement’s pioneer Georges Seurat—employs meticulous dabs of pure color to depict a nude bather in a serene, private moment. The composition exudes tranquility, with soft, shimmering light playing across her skin and the surrounding space, evoking a dreamlike quality. Though less renowned than Seurat or Signac, Petitjean’s work reflects the scientific rigor and aesthetic harmony of Divisionism, contributing to post-Impressionism’s exploration of light and form. This piece stands as a testament to the movement’s lyrical potential, bridging technical precision with emotive grace.
